Q1: Is the gestation period always exactly 63 days?
A: While 63 days is the average, normal gestation can range from 58-68 days depending on the breed and individual dog.
Q2: When should I schedule a veterinary visit?
A: Schedule a prenatal check-up about 3-4 weeks after mating for confirmation of pregnancy and health assessment.
Q3: What are signs of approaching labor?
A: Nesting behavior, temperature drop, loss of appetite, and restlessness typically occur 24-48 hours before delivery.
Q4: Should I prepare a whelping box?
A: Yes, prepare a quiet, comfortable whelping area about one week before the expected due date.
Q5: When should I seek veterinary assistance?
A: Contact your vet if labor doesn't begin within 24 hours of temperature drop, or if more than 2 hours pass between puppies with obvious straining.
